In 2019-2020, 5,707 people earned their degree in teaching English as a second or foreign language/ESL language instructor, making the major the 182nd most popular in the United States.
At the doctor’s degree level specifically, there were 31 teaching English as a second or foreign language/ESL language instructor graduates with average earnings and debt of $72,680 and $116,043 respectively.
